Lyu Fan

Lyu Fan is a researcher and Ph.D. supervisor at the National Center for STD/AIDS Control and Prevention, China Center for Disease Control and Prevention.
Dr. Lyu is the recipient of the State Council Special Allowance (2020).
Dr. Lyu serves as the Chairman of the Epidemiology and Monitoring and Evaluation Committee Chinese Association for STD/AIDS Control and Prevention.
In past years, Dr. Lyu has been mainly engaged in the prevention and control of diseases such as AIDS, viral hepatitis, and monkeypox, carrying out a series of research projects on major infectious disease epidemiology, prevention and control policy and strategies, monkeypox and HIV co-infection, and HIV and viral hepatitis co-infection. He has conducted pilot study and explored the pathway for integrated control and prevention of AIDS, hepatitis, STD and monkeypox.
Dr. Lyu participated in COVID-19 epidemic prevention and control, including on-site prevention and control in several provinces as a member of epidemiological investigation. As a technical consultant, he supported the COVID-19 prevention and control in Italy and performed outstandingly in the epidemic investigation and community prevention and control. In view of Dr. Lyu's outstanding performance in the prevention and control of the COVID-19 epidemic, he was commended by the leaders of the National Health Commission, Ministry of Foreign Affairs, and National Disease Control and Prevention Administration.
His research results provided scientific evidence for national policy and strategy on HIV prevention, and have won more than 10 science and technology awards, including the second prize of the Chinese Medical Science and Technology Award, the second prize of the Chinese Preventive Medicine Society Science and Technology Award, and the second prize of the Huaxia Medical Science and Technology Award. As the first or corresponding author, he has published more than 270 articles in Chinese or English, and edited/co-edited 10 books. Additionally, he has mentored 39 doctoral and master’s students.
